On this show, we discuss common issues small business owners deal with when classifying workers as independent contractors. Any business that uses independent contractors in Massachusetts should be certain that these workers are classified properly. The failure to do so can – and very often does – result in statutorily mandated penalties of treble damages, attorney’s fees and costs as well as personal liability.
We review the criteria and some facts to help small business owners understand how to properly classify workers. We also review the facts and decisions from some recent cases to give small business owners some context.
